Abstract

Speaker recognition is the process of identifying a speaker by his/her speech samples. By extracting the speaker-specific features from the speech samples, the recognition task can be done. The formant estimation of speech sample of specific speaker is important for feature extraction in speaker recognition, because the formants are unique and reflect the vocal tract information of a speaker. In the proposed work Linear Predictive Coding (LPC) based formant estimation method is employed as it is more efficient and accurate. The formant frequencies of each speaker are evaluated and stored in the database and test speaker speech sample is also processed in the same way to find the formants and finally they are compared with the formants stored in the database to perform the speaker verification and recognition.
